PAN Foundation Acute Myeloid Leukemia Disease Fund
PAN Foundation
The PAN Foundation offers transportation grants to assist patients with Acute Myeloid Leukemia. These grants cover transportation-related purchases for eligible individuals managing their condition.

Eligibility
Patients must be receiving treatment for acute myeloid leukemia in the United States and have government-insured health coverage like Medicare or Medicaid. Eligibility also requires a household income at or below 500% of the Federal Poverty Level.
